India inspires us this month with its lotus flower as a sacred symbol of purity and a cosmic union of earth, water, and sky.

We think it makes a beautiful statement as our August Quilt Block of the Month.

This intermediate-level project cuts bonded fabric to create an India-inspired floral applique quilt block as part of a 9-block quilt series. For this block, you only need seven fabric colors (including the white background) and a single color of iron-on for the accents. This project works for more than just quilts — if you’re making a project that benefits from repeating patterns, like a table runner, this block works perfectly.

A few things to keep in mind when you’re preparing for this project:

  • We recommend reading through the entire project detail.
  • To make changes to this project, use the Mat Preview screen to move pieces and reduce waste. Don’t forget to mirror all of the mats except the pieces in white.
  • Apply applique material (such as HeatnBond Lite) to the wrong side of all of the colors of fabric (except white) using applique product instructions. Remove the paper liner once the material has properly bonded and cooled before cutting.
